Chromatomyia aprilina (Goureau, 1851) (a leaf-mining fly)

Record info

Date: 13 July 2002
Location: Berks, England
Voucher: 13/07/2002[C]
State: Pupa
Record Summary: Leaf miner on Honeysuckle
Associated organism: underside living leaf of Lonicera periclymenum
Image Reference: P37138

Please mention P37138 in any enquiries regarding this image.

Mine - leaf underside - enlarged - with puparium
